Description
The beta and the 1.0 both would crash on launch and I kept seeing strange "AMFI failed to unserialize XML, line 1" errors constantly in my dmesg. (I thought it was very odd your installer creates libusb /usr/lib symlinks in postinst in a non-kosher manner that doesn't respect dpkg (it silently breaks usbmuxd2 because it changes the md5sum). This should be revised to a proper method.)
Anyway I finally found the problem: your /Applications/LiNUZE/Entitlements.plist is a bplist; it needs to be an XML. I used plutil to convert and then resign with ldid and now it launches for the first time.
Then I discovered you broke my /usr/sbin/usbmuxd with the same corrupt entitlements signing in your postinst, this was the cause of my constant AMFI failed to unserialize dmesg errors (iOS kept trying to launch org.libimobiledevice.usbmuxd and failing.)
After signing usbmuxd with the XML entitlements, now it works.
iOS 14.4
iPad Pro 11" 2018 iPad8,4
Unc0ver 8.0.2
with my own custom Procursus repo debs implemented in an Unc0ver-compatible fashion (all /usr and zero /opt).
I saw someone on Reddit r/jailbreak with the same failure, so I assume this is happening to every unc0ver iOS 14.4-14.8 user.
